Huge 7.6 magnitude earthquake strikes Papua New Guinea

 Huge 7.6 magnitude earthquake strikes Papua New Guinea cracking roads, wrecking shops – and shaking parts of Australia

  • 7.6 magnitude earthquake hit Eastern New Guinea region in Papua New Guinea
  • Photos and video show damaged buildings, cars, roads and supermarkets
  • Bureau of Meteorology said there is no immediate tsunami threat to Australia

    An earthquake with a magnitude of 7.6 has struck Papua New Guinea causing widespread panic.
  • The earthquake hit on Sunday with locals reporting power outages and damaged infrastructure including major buildings, homes, and roads.

    There have not been any reports of casualties and authorities are yet to officially confirm property damage.
